Pros

First off, they care. Managers through exec team listen to staff and make adjustments to make the work easier. Never see that anywhere else in the industry. Teams are great, lots of good folks across the organization willing to help. Tons of growth, development, and responsibilities available to folks who want it. Never forced into anything, but also surrounded by a great support system when entering uncharted territory. Bonuses, yearly increases, peer awards, seniority awards, random days off- the list is endless with perks. It’s give and take though, the work can be heavy.

Cons

Industry is extremely demanding, can’t blame any company for that. Legal work is what it is. Could use more automation, but heading down the right path currently.
